15 Most Cash Rich Companies [+My predictions]

NVDL: Expect Pfizer, Shell, Johnson and Johnson and Apple to move up the charts. Exxon will remain prominent. I am not sure about the prospects for Intel, Microsoft and Toyota. All require a lot of money to buy, and energy to run - neither of which will be in abundance in the medium term. In a decade, more than half the company's on this list will no longer be on it, if not more, and all the amounts - in real terms - will have been reduced from the current levels. Everyone is about to get poorer.
clipped from seekingalpha.com
  1. Exxon Mobil - (XOM), Chart, Total Cash: $32.007 Billion
  2. Cisco Systems - (CSCO), Chart, Total Cash: $29.531 Billion
  3. Apple - (AAPL), Chart, Total Cash: $25.647 Billion
  4. Berkshire Hathaway - (BRK.A), Chart, Total Cash: $25.539 Billion
  5. Pfizer Inc - (PFE), Chart, Total Cash: $23.731 Billion
  6. Toyota Motor - (TM), Chart, Total Cash: $23.151 Billion
  7. Microsoft - (MSFT), Chart, Total Cash: $20.298 Billion
  8. Google - (GOOG), Chart, Total Cash: $15.846 Billion
  9. Royal Dutch Shell - (RDS.A), Chart, Total Cash: $15.188 Billion
  10. Wyeth - (WYE), Chart, Total Cash: $14.54 Billion
  11. IBM - (IBM), Chart, Total Cash: $12.907 Billion
  12. Johnson & Johnson - (JNJ), Chart, Total Cash: $12.809 Billion
  13. Intel - (INTC), Chart, Total Cash: $11.843 Billion
  14. Hewlett Packard - (HPQ), Chart, Total Cash: $11.255 Billion
  15. Oracle - (ORCL), Chart, Total Cash: $10.646 Billion
